Tulum Vs Playa Del Carmen Vs Cancun – Where to Go During Sargassum Season?

The Mexican Caribbean, known for its pristine beaches and turquoise waters, faces a seasonal challenge from May to September: sargassum seaweed.

This natural occurrence affects different areas along the coast to varying degrees, making the choice of destination during this period crucial for beachgoers.

Here’s a detailed comparison of Tulum, Playa del Carmen, and Cancun to help you decide where to visit during the sargassum season.

Understanding the Sargassum Season

Sargassum is a type of brown algae that washes ashore in large quantities, affecting the aesthetic and environmental quality of the beaches.

When it decomposes, it emits a pungent odor, diminishing the beach experience. The extent of sargassum invasion can vary significantly based on location, ocean currents, and weather patterns.

Cancun: The Safe Bet

Cancun generally experiences less severe sargassum influx compared to its southern neighbors, thanks to its unique geographical configuration and ocean currents. Beaches like Playa Delfines and Playa Norte on Isla Mujeres often remain relatively free from sargassum, maintaining their allure for tourists.

Advantages:

  • Cleaner Beaches: Cancun’s beaches are less affected by sargassum, making it a safer choice for those prioritizing a beach-centric vacation.
  • Resort Experience: Known for its luxury resorts and vibrant nightlife, Cancun offers a comprehensive tourist experience, including fine dining, shopping, and entertainment.
  • Accessibility: Cancun’s international airport makes it easily accessible for travelers from around the globe.

Disadvantages:

  • Crowds: The popularity of Cancun can lead to crowded beaches and tourist spots, especially during peak seasons.
  • Commercial Atmosphere: Some travelers might find Cancun too commercialized compared to the more laid-back vibe of the Riviera Maya.

Playa del Carmen: The Middle Ground

Playa del Carmen often finds itself in the middle ground in terms of sargassum impact. While some beaches are affected, others manage to stay relatively clear, thanks to the efforts of local authorities and resorts.

Advantages:

  • Diverse Activities: Playa del Carmen offers a mix of beach relaxation and urban attractions, including the famous Fifth Avenue with its shops, restaurants, and nightlife.
  • Cultural Exposure: The town provides opportunities to experience local culture and cuisine more intimately than Cancun.
  • Strategic Location: It serves as a convenient base for exploring nearby attractions like Cozumel, cenotes, and Mayan ruins.

Disadvantages:

  • Variable Beach Conditions: The presence of sargassum can be unpredictable, with some beaches more affected than others.
  • Resort Quality: While there are many excellent resorts, the overall quality can vary, and some might not handle sargassum as effectively as others.

Tulum: The Natural Escape

Tulum, renowned for its bohemian vibe and eco-friendly resorts, is often more heavily impacted by sargassum due to its location. However, it offers unique attractions that can make up for this.

Advantages:

  • Natural Beauty: Tulum’s beaches, when free of sargassum, are among the most beautiful, characterized by their pristine sand and clear waters.
  • Historical Sites: The nearby Tulum ruins provide a stunning backdrop and an educational experience.
  • Eco-tourism: The area is rich in cenotes and nature reserves, offering plenty of alternative activities to beachgoing.

Disadvantages:

  • Higher Sargassum Impact: Tulum’s beaches are often more affected by sargassum, which can detract from the beach experience.
  • Accessibility and Cost: Tulum is less accessible than Cancun and Playa del Carmen, and it can be more expensive due to its boutique hotels and eco-resorts.

Making the Decision

Your choice between Cancun, Playa del Carmen, and Tulum during the sargassum season ultimately depends on your priorities:

  • For Pristine Beaches: Choose Cancun for its relatively sargassum-free beaches and comprehensive tourist amenities.
  • For a Balanced Experience: Playa del Carmen offers a mix of urban and beach experiences, with moderate sargassum impact.
  • For Eco-Tourism and History: Opt for Tulum if you are interested in natural beauty, historical sites, and eco-friendly accommodations, despite the higher sargassum presence.

Regardless of the destination, staying informed about current beach conditions and choosing accommodations that actively manage sargassum can enhance your vacation experience.
